Detailed explanation-1: -Cyanobacteria refer to a group of gram-negative bacteria that are aquatic and photosynthetic. They are prokaryotic in nature. They do not possess cell organelles and a distinct nucleus. As all the prokaryotes fall under kingdom monera so cyanobacteria are classified under the kingdom monera.

Detailed explanation-2: -Cyanobacteria are classified in the kingdom Monera, phylum Cyanobacteria; are considered to be more closely related to bacteria; and are no longer considered members of the plant family.

Detailed explanation-3: -Blue-green algae or Cyanobacteria are photosynthetic bacteria but they are placed under kingdom Monera because they are unicellular, they show prokaryotic features like lack of a well defined nucleus.

Detailed explanation-4: -Cyanobacteria, formerly known as blue-green algae, are photosynthetic microscopic organisms that are technically bacteria.
